I have a 15 gallon and I currently have:
2- otocinclus
4- neon tetra
1- albino Pleco
1-black neon tetra
3-white clouds

I want to get something a little bigger to add to my tank. Any suggestions? No Mollies or guppies, I don't want to deal with salts.

You are pretty stocked up for that tank size. I am not sure a larger fish would fit in and overstocked tanks cause more problems than you maybe want. If you must have another, I would go with a dwarf gourami. They are cool and pretty.
 
I would get rid of the minnows and black neon and bump your neon school to at least 6. I'm with ppo, a dwarf gourami would be nice.

What is the reasoning for getting rid of the minnows and the black neon? Just curiosity.

All of the fish that you have, except for the pleco, are shoaling fish that need to be kept in groups of six or more (you may be OK with 3-4 otos, though). If they're in smaller numbers, they'll be stressed and more disease-prone.

You're being told to get rid of a couple of species because a 15 gallon tank isn't spacious enough to keep proper shoals of all of those species.

I got my albino bristle nose pleco three months ago at 1 inch long. It is now 5 inches long and almost a deep orange color (very pretty!). I think this is pretty rapid growth for a pleco. I personally feel plecos need driftwood (I like mopani because it sinks right away, but it will tint your water for a long time). It is also important to know that algae tabs alone will not satisfy them. They need meaty foods too like brine shrimp, pellets, blood worms, etc.
